BrandModelRev LanReady WUB1900RT
Interface USB 2.0
Connector Male A
Form factor nano dongle
FCCID SCD030025
Chip1 Realtek RTL8188CUS

OUI: none specified

MIMO status 1x1:1
Wireless Standards IEEE 802.11b/g/n
802.11n up to 150 Mbps
802.11g up to 54 Mbps
802.11b up to 11 Mbps
Operating Frequency 2.4 GHz

Probable Linux driver
rtl8192cu, rtl8xxxu (WIP?) (in backports)

Overview

The FCC test report lists the following models as identical..

  • BlueStork BS-WN-USB
  • Airlink101 AWLL5099
  • Cerio UW-200N-PRO
  • Kozumi K-1500MU
  • Wavecore WUB-100-nano
